Sage Sankara's Advaitic wisdom is pure spirituality or Adyathma.+

 

Adyatma has nothing to do with religious sects or creeds and religious beliefs or any philosophy or Guru's teaching. Adyatma is pure Spirituality. Knowledge of Atma is Adyatma. Advaita is Adyatma. 

Adyatma is the knowledge of the truth beyond form, time, and space. Bifurcate religion, yoga, and theoretical philosophy and base the truth on the Athma. Knowledge-based on Athma is Adyathma.

Adyatma is based on the Athma or Spirit, which is the Self.

Sage Sankara's Advaitic wisdom is pure spirituality or Adyathma

Failure to grasp this truth alone results in an egocentric personality. The Seeker has to refrain from talking about anything other than this all-pervading consciousness. Consciousness is within the three states, but it is without the three states. 

Consciousness is within the three states because it is the cause of the three states and it, itself is uncaused.  Consciousness is without the three states because the three states are merely an illusion created out of consciousness. 

Thus, the three states are nothing but consciousness. Thus,  consciousness alone is real and eternal.

The essence of truth is hidden within the three states and it is without the three states. 

The seeker has to just reflect and sincerely recognize the presence of consciousness in everything and everywhere in all three states which leads to Advaitic Self-awareness in the midst of the diversity. In the domain of the Soul, there is unity in diversity.
